            Dodgers hit 7 homers in 8-7 win over Mets





            By The Associated Press                                                                                             earned his seventh save.
            NEW  YORK  (AP)  —  Jus-                                                                                            The start of the game was
            tin  Turner  hit  Los  Angeles'                                                                                     delayed  1  hour,  31  min-
            seventh  home  run  of  the                                                                                         utes by a strong storm that
            game,  a  go-ahead  drive                                                                                           dropped  heavy  rain  and
            in the 11th inning that lifted                                                                                      hail on Coors Field.
            the Dodgers over the New                                                                                            Nolan Arenado and Gerar-
            York Mets 8-7 on Sunday.                                                                                            do Parra homered for Colo-
            Cody  Bellinger  and  Kike                                                                                          rado. German Marquez (5-
            Hernandez     each    hom-                                                                                          8) was tagged for six runs in
            ered  twice  as  the  Dodg-                                                                                         3 1/3 innings.
